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Radcliffe (Nottinghamshire) to Orpington start from as little as £20.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Radcliffe (Nottinghamshire) to Orpington start from £86.60 one way, or £90.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Radcliffe (Nottinghamshire) to Orpington are available for £136.90 one way, or £267.90 return

Station Facilities and User Experience

Radcliffe station embraces simplicity. Ticket purchasing facilities are minimal, with no ticket office or collection machines available. While the absence of these might sound inconvenient, it adds to the station's unique charm of encouraging passengers to plan ahead and purchase tickets online or via mobile apps.

This station is equipped with vital information facilities, including help points with induction loops to assist passengers, particularly those who are hearing-impaired. However, there are no customer services staff or waiting rooms, offering a serene throughway rather than a bustling hub. Accessibility is a conscious effort at Radcliffe, with step-free access available to Platform 1. For those needing assistance, advanced booking through Passenger Assist is suggested to ensure a smooth journey.

Onward Travel Options

Leaving the station, Radcliffe offers a variety of seamless onward travel options. Rail replacement services are conveniently located on the station site. Taxis are easily accessible with services like East Notts and Blue Link ready to drive you to your next destination. State-of-the-Art Facilities Catered to Your Needs

The ticket office at Orpington Station is open every day of the week, from 6:05 am to 9:00 pm on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ly later from 6:45 am on Sundays. For those in a rush, ticket machines and collection points are readily available, and smartcards can be both issued and validated here. Accessibility is a priority too, with step-free access to all platforms, accessible ticket machines located conveniently on the station forecourt, and ample seating areas. While there are no traditional waiting rooms, the station is equipped with seating, and for families, baby-changing facilities are available near Platform 2.

When it comes to refreshment, don't worry—you won't leave Orpington parched or hungry. Enjoy a hot beverage or make use of the vending machines on Platform 2. There's also an ATM and a newsagent for those quick needs. The station's undergone a modern makeover in amenities, ensuring you have access to the essentials, even if there's no currency exchange service available.

Smooth Connections: The Ease of Onward Travel

Orpington Station is a transport hub with seamless connections to local destinations and beyond. A variety of bus services can whisk you away toward Chislehurst, Lewisham, Bromley South, and Sevenoaks. For precise routes, you can find printed journey planners at the station, or use the convenient "what 3 words" service to locate the exact bus stops near Platform 5 and on Crofton Road. Although there are no on-site cycle hire facilities, bike storage is plentiful and monitored by CCTV.

If you'd rather take a taxi, the front forecourt is your go-to. For drivers, APCOA Parking offers 319 spaces, including 13 dedicated accessible spaces, with round-the-clock availability and competitive rates, including a new evening rate of just £1.50 post-6 pm. Luggage storage, however, is one area where you'll have to make alternative arrangements as it's unavailable on-site.
